About
Dr. Gabriel Hermosilla is a leading researcher in robotics and artificial intelligence, with a primary focus on human-robot interaction (HRI), deep reinforcement learning (DRL), and autonomous navigation. His work bridges the gap between simulation and real-world deployment, particularly for service and environmental robotics. A major contribution is his pioneering use of thermal and visual information for human detection and identification in domestic environments, as demonstrated in his highly cited 2011 paper (65 citations), which laid groundwork for safer, more responsive home robots. He has also advanced the field of robot control through DRL, notably proposing novel algorithms for position control of mobile robots using the OpenAI Gym and CoppeliaSim platforms (2022, 23 citations). Hermosilla’s impact is further evidenced by his development of an easy-to-use DRL library for AI mobile robots in Isaac Sim (2022, 23 citations), making sophisticated simulation tools accessible to engineers. His recent work on Sim-to-Real transfer for beach-cleaning robots (2025, 4 citations) showcases applied innovation, achieving reliable navigation with minimal sensors. Additionally, his comparative study on face recognition using thermal infrared images for HRI (2009, 19 citations) remains influential. Through these achievements, Hermosilla is shaping the future of autonomous, interactive robots.
